SPA3102: Call fails with NORMAL_TEMPORARY_FAILURE

mcampbellsmith
Level 1
Level 1

Hi!

I am using freeswitch to connect to my SPA3102 which is registered using TLS.  Quite often I see the following, which results in FreeSwitch ending the call with NORMAL_TEMPORARY_FAILURE.

The syslog from the SPA3102 looks like this:


Mar 19 19:58:15 x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x CC:pc(1)=130 not in codec list
Mar 19 19:58:15 x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x [0:0]AUD ALLOC CALL (port=30322)
Mar 19 19:58:15 x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x [0:0]RTP Rx Up
Mar 19 19:58:15 x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x [0]->124.xxx.xxx.xxx:442(519)
Mar 19 19:58:15 x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x [0]->124.xxx.xxx.xxx:442(519)
Mar 19 19:58:15 x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x SIP/2.0 180 Ringing  To: <sip:2001@x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x:5070;transport=tls>;tag=80a48d552a9b8589i0  From: "anonymous" <sip:anonymous@124.xxx.xxx.xxx>;tag=BFgcyp329X51S  Call-ID: 650ac1cf-add8-122d-71b8-00e04c0312e9  CSeq: 128376211 INVITE  Via: SIP/2.0/TLS 124.xxx.xxx.xxx:442;branch=z9hG4bK2U30XeKBjamap;rport=442  Contact: 2001 <sip:2001@x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x:5070;transport=tls>  Server: Linksys/SPA3102-5.1.10(GW)  Remote-Party-ID: 2001 <sip:2001@mydns.dyndns.org:442>;screen=yes;party=called  Content-Length: 0 
Mar 19 19:58:15 x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x
Mar 19 19:58:15 x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x
Mar 19 19:58:15 x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x [0]SIP/TCP ServerDisconnected:-257
Mar 19 19:58:15 x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x [0]SIP/TCP ServerDisconnected:-257
Mar 19 19:58:15 x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x [0]FM Alert Stop RxTx (c=0024e6b0;a=0)
Mar 19 19:58:15 x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x [0:0]AUD Rel Call
Mar 19 19:58:15 x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x CC:Failed w/ Ringing
Mar 19 19:58:15 x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x DLG Terminated 2a8d10
Mar 19 19:58:15 x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x Sess Terminated

Can someone explain why this might be failing?  Thanks!
